Avenue Q is a hilarious, heartwarming, and slightly naughty musical that blends puppetry with live actors to explore the ups and downs of adulthood.

 

Set on a fictional New York street, the story follows Princeton, a recent college graduate, as he searches for his purpose in life. Along the way, he meets a colorful group of neighbours — both humans and puppets — who navigate love, work, identity, and the messy realities of growing up.

 

With catchy songs like It Sucks to Be Me and Everyone’s a Little Bit Racist, Avenue Q is a bold, satirical, and unforgettable coming-of-age musical that’s both outrageous and relatable.
